Kelsier is tall and hawk-faced and has light-blonde hair and hazel eyes{{book ref|mb1|3}}{{wob ref|9216}}; he has a multitude of large scars crossing both arms from his time in the Pits of Hathsin.{{book ref|mb1|prologue}} He usually wears a nobleman's suit (a colored vest with dark trousers and a coat), and for night time activities his [[mistcloak]].
He is almost always late to gatherings, which he attributes to always having somewhere better to be{{book ref|mb1|27}}. He always smiles and projects an excited and positive attitude, which is particularly unusual in the skaa underground. He does this in order to fight the Lord Ruler's oppression of all the skaa,
Some might say that Kelsier is a psychopath, though this is debatable due to the intense anger he exhibits when innocents (or rather his idea of innocents) are harmed, which is a very empathetic trait. He also shows regret and guilt for what happened to Vin in the aftermath of the Kredik Shaw burglary. Throughout the series, he has fond memories of his wife whom he misses greatly, whose death caused him to snap into Allomancy. Nevertheless, Sanderson states that Kelsier derives pleasure from killing people, but only allows that part of his personality to surface occasionally when he is fighting noblemen, and he tries to channel this aspect of his personality into a good cause.{{wob ref|4103}} This leads us to believe that he isn't a psychopath by definition, he is most likely insane in another way.
